Media Encoder exceeds memory limit and crashes

Hi,

as stated above: Media Encoder doesn't care about the memory limit i set. When reaching 100% memory load the ME crashes.

I tried several settings of the limit (between 26 and 10 GB), reinstalled the newest nvidia graphics driver and tested using a brandnew admin Windows-Account (that's what Adobe Support said i should try). All with the same result: exceeding and crashing.

 

I've got 32 GB of RAM, Win 10, AME v22.2 (but was the same with an older version.

 

Any hint what i could try?
